440 Hz Trio


Main image

Originally a jazz trio from Hamburg, Germany, founded by Richard von der Schulenburg, Olve Strelow and John Raphael Burgess in 2005. Recorded two album with Jacques Palminger in 2012 and 2016, permanently adding vibraphonist Jan Heinemann to the group in 2014. Heinemann left the band in 2020. As of 2024, the band is known as 440 Hertz, with Lydia Schmidt (vocals, organ) and Lieven Brunckhorst (flute, saxophone) as permanent members. Friedrich Paravicini (strings) and Carsten Erobique Meyer (keys) have been regular collaborators with the group.
